New Meadowlands :: AP

It's official. The New York/New Jersey area will host the 2014 Super Bowl at the new $1.6 billion Meadowlands in East Rutherford, N.J. The NFL owners made the announcement Tuesday.

The decision by the owners sets a precedent, as it will be the first Super Bowl played outdoors in a cold-weather city. This begs the question: Will other cold-weather NFL franchises with outdoor stadiums, like the Broncos, Patriots, Redskins and Packers, now lobby for future Super Bowls?
